International Business Law and Arbitration in OHADA

How 17 African Countries Harmonized their Business Law and Arbitrate Issues
Wednesday, February 14, 2018 12:00 pm - 6:59 pm

Join the International Arbitration Student Association and the Law, Justice, and International Development Society for a presentation on "International Business Law and Arbitration in OHADA: How 17 African Countries Harmonized their Business Law and Arbitrate Issues." The presentation will feature Mahutodji Jimmy Vital Kodo, Special Advisor to the President, Common Court of Justice and Arbitration of OHADA.

KodoMahutodji Jimmy Vital Kodo
Technical Advisor to the President
Common Court of Justice and Arbitration of OHADA. 

Mr. Kodo is an Attorney at Law from France. For the last two years he has been the technical advisor to the President of the Common Court of Justice and Arbitration of the Organization for Harmonization of Business Law in Africa. He has published extensively on the OHADA, included the first comprehensive case law study on OHADA law since its establishment in 1993.
